Lights Out by Chance Slaughter
An arcade like strategy wave shooter. Survive through tougher waves while protecting you're Generator. You are invincible, but your beacon is not. You can find how to play, and controls inside the game. My personal high score is ~177000. Have Fun! P.S(You may need winrar or a different file opener to open it.)

Aside from that the gameplay itself is pretty solid. Biggest weakness is probably the graphics - not that they were bad (in fact I really liked the style). Rather, they tend to negatively impact gameplay - there's no feedback to tell me that I hit an enemy, and the ground near the generator is so busy that it's hard to tell what's solid and what's not.
To improve, my main issue was my character and the bullets getting stuck on the generator, as well as the buyable walls really just being a way to unleash a flood of zombies on yourself. I agree that the player shouldn't be able to just sit in the middle and spray down all enemies on the map but the player and bullets getting stuck was frustrating especially when enemies were swarming the generator.
